求助:vbox创建‘持续写入’镜像失败

Kvm、VMware、Virtualbox、Xen、Qemu 等
回复
pengtu
帖子: 349
注册时间: 2006-09-09 0:35
送出感谢: 3 次
接收感谢: 0

求助:vbox创建‘持续写入’镜像失败

#1

帖子 pengtu » 2007-07-12 18:50

持续写入类型的vdi文件就是可以在关闭客机,清除快照的情况下仍然保留磁盘内容的镜像类型,术语是:Writer-Through,在主机内用命令行创建:

代码: 全选

D:\VirtualBox>vboxmanage createvdi -type writethrough -filename new.vdi -size 2048
显示vdi文件创建后的编号:
VirtualBox Command Line Management Interface Version 1.4.0
(C) 2005-2007 innotek GmbH
All rights reserved.

Disk image created. UUID: 9f53129d-e499-467f-8511-07ba9dc14fe0
用命令检查生成的new.vdi类型:

代码: 全选

D:\VirtualBox>vboxmanage showvdiinfo new3.vdi
其中显示:
UUID: 9f53129d-e499-467f-8511-07ba9dc14fe0
Registered: yes
Accessible: yes
Size: 2048 MBytes
Current size on disk: 0 MBytes
Type: standard
Storage type: Virtual Disk Image (VDI)
In use by VM: <none>
Path: E:\new.vdi
为什么还是standard(normal)呢?
经过实际运行,确实不能保存我拷贝进去的文件,请教!
pengtu
帖子: 349
注册时间: 2006-09-09 0:35
送出感谢: 3 次
接收感谢: 0

#2

帖子 pengtu » 2007-07-13 12:39

这个问题没人关心么?用处很大啊,可以利用这种镜像精简vdi的体积。
头像
xrfang
帖子: 1116
注册时间: 2006-12-08 10:21
送出感谢: 0
接收感谢: 0

#3

帖子 xrfang » 2007-08-26 16:40

这个write-through的意思我看了文档好像是指这类磁盘不受snapshot保护的意思。换句话说,如果你使用了快照,那么当你恢复快照的时候,这些write-through的磁盘不会被恢复。

比如说,我们可以把C盘作为系统盘,受snapshot保护,而D盘作为数据盘,使用write-through,在我们恢复快照的时候不会丢失数据。
头像
xrfang
帖子: 1116
注册时间: 2006-12-08 10:21
送出感谢: 0
接收感谢: 0

#4

帖子 xrfang » 2007-08-26 16:42

write-through的数据直接写到vdi里面了,因此是不受保护的。而一般磁盘的内容是写到Machine子目录下的snapshot里面的。换句话说,write-through就是没有镜像(snapshot)的意思
回复

回到 “虚拟机和虚拟化”